A 10-year-old child was hospitalized after being struck by a car on Park Avenue in Cranston on Saturday, according to police.
Officers responded to the area of 820 Park Ave. at approximately 1:52 p.m. that afternoon following reports of the incident. Police say their investigation found the child had apparently run into traffic and been struck by a vehicle that was traveling east.
The child was transported to Hasbro Children’s Hospital, according to police, and was initially listed in critical condition before reportedly being upgraded to stable condition.
No additional information regarding the child or the driver of the vehicle was released, and police said the incident remains under investigation by certified accident reconstruction personnel.
